The Digital Backbone of Modern Skyscraper Development

In the past decade, the construction and management of skyscrapers have transcended traditional architectural practices. The proliferation of building information modeling (BIM) systems, geographic information systems (GIS), and real-time monitoring platforms has transformed how stakeholders access critical project data. These innovations contribute to accelerated decision-making, increased safety, and optimized resource allocation.

At the heart of this digital transformation lies a concept often underappreciated: the data portal. Think of it as a centralized hub—an integrated digital portal—that consolidates disparate datasets related to urban infrastructure, construction permits, zoning laws, environmental impact assessments, and structural specifications.

Why a ‘portal’ Matters in Urban High-Rise Development

A credible data portal acts as an authoritative digital interface, enabling stakeholders to efficiently navigate the complex web of urban data. It enhances transparency, reduces information silos, and promotes informed decision-making, fostering a collaborative environment among architects, engineers, authorities, and the public.
